Fast-Paced Ice Rink ChallengesFor teenagers who thrive on friendly competition and high energy, introducing structured games onto the ice completely changes the dynamic. Simple childhood games take on an entirely new level of difficulty and excitement when you substitute sneakers for steel blades. Try a game of ice tag, where the boundaries are restricted to the hockey circles or the blue lines to keep the action localized and safe. Another excellent option is an obstacle course challenge using casual rink markers like plastic cones or lightweight foam blocks. Skaters can compete for the fastest time while weaving through cones, performing a clean stop, and skating backward for a short distance. These activities build incredible balance and edge control without ever feeling like a chore or a repetitive workout routine.
Skill-Building and Visual GoalsLearning a new physical skill provides a massive rush of adrenaline and a great sense of personal achievement. Instead of just gliding in endless circles around the perimeter, focus on mastering a specific, impressive-looking skating maneuver during a single session. The standard forward crossover is a perfect starting point, allowing skaters to maintain high speeds while effortlessly carving around sharp corners. For those who already possess basic balance, mastering the hockey stop creates a satisfying spray of ice shavings and stops momentum instantly. Another popular visual goal is learning how to transition smoothly from forward skating to backward skating without losing speed. Achieving these milestones gives teenagers tangible goals to work toward and share with their peers, turning an ordinary afternoon into a rewarding masterclass.
